#a247e1 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#a247e1 is composed of 63.5% red, 27.8%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28% cyan, 68.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 275.5 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 58%. #a247e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8eff with #4500c3.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

● #a247e1 color description : Soft violet.
The hexadecimal color #a247e1 has RGB values of R:162, G:71,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 10635233.
